08 May 07 - QlikTech Raises the Bar for In-Memory BI with Release of QlikView 7.5

QlikTech, Inc., the world's fastest-growing business intelligence software company, today announced version 7.5 of QlikView, the company's fast and flexible business analysis solution. The latest version of the company's industry-leading solution brings the power of enterprise-class business intelligence to the entire enterprise.  New enhancements to QlikView 7.5 improve end-user access to data analysis, streamline application development, and enhance overall flexibility.   QlikTech has also introduced a new pricing model, simplifying how companies buy and use BI tools.

In a recent Gartner report, co-author and research director, Kurt Schlegel states, "Organisations are increasing their spending, particularly as BI evolves from its reactive, departmental roots to become more pervasive and strategic.  The increasing scope of BI platforms to include more users and access to more data sources will perpetuate the market growth. Traditionally, BI was just for senior executives and analysts, but many enterprises are extending their BI platform capabilities throughout the organisation to operational workers and managers." 

QlikView version 7.5 delivers significant enhancements, helping to improve ease-of-use and streamline the functions of application development and administration.  New integration options in 7.5, including support for Web Services, mean that QlikView users can access and analyse information from even more data sources.   Additionally, QlikTech has introduced a new pricing model.  With QlikView 7.5 customers have the flexibility to purchase licenses on a usage basis - meaning they only have to buy what they use. 

"The new functionality within QlikView 7.5 offers us the flexibility to address new groups of users within our company who previously would not have been business intelligence users," said Ted Dimbero, vice president of operations, of Zyme Solutions.  "QlikView 7.5 has allowed us the ability to develop new analyses quickly, ensuring that we are able to meet our customer's needs efficiently and accurately."

What's New:

  • Simplified User Experience - There are several improvements to QlikView 7.5 that make the tool easier to learn and use, improving productivity and reducing ramp-up time for users.  Improvements include a new start-up interface, an integrated web browser to create a 'home page' for users to begin their analysis, and new 'What-If' comparison tools to help users understand and compare analyses. 

  • New Application Development Tools - New development tools include a KPI library giving an overview of all metrics being tracked, new wizards, and improved reports.  These tools help reduce the time it takes to develop new analyses. 

  • Streamlined Administration Tools - Simplified tools for deploying, managing and updating QlikView enable it to fit seamlessly into an organisation's existing IT environment. 

  • Support for Web Services - QlikView 7.5 includes new plug-ins for a variety of additional data sources.  A Web Services plug-in enables users to interface with custom data sources from almost any SOA application.  

  • Flexibility - QlikView 7.5 offers new analysis tools for on-the-fly creation of new dimensions, infinitely nested aggregation and statistical analysis.   This allows users complete freedom in their analysis - analyses can be modified in seconds - and gives users the power to explore data in new and more complete ways.  

  • Desktop QlikView - QlikView 7.5 makes it easier than ever for users to load local data and combine it with corporate data sources for fast personalised analysis.
